Common Garbage Disposal Issues in Huntsville Homes

Jammed Impellers

Impellers grind food waste into fine particles, but fibrous vegetables, bones, or non-food items can lodge between the impeller and the shredder ring. A jammed mechanism strains the motor, leading to humming without full rotation and, eventually, shutdowns triggered by the unit’s overload protector.

Grinding Noises

Unusual metallic or rattling sounds often indicate foreign objects—utensils, bottle caps, or plastic fragments—lodged inside the grinding chamber. Huntsville’s hard water can also cause mineral buildup that erodes internal components, amplifying noise levels during operation.

Persistent Odors

Food residue trapped in the splash guard or deep within the grinding plate creates foul smells that linger despite basic cleaning. In Huntsville’s humid climate, bacteria multiply faster, so odors intensify when disposal maintenance lapses.

Unit Won’t Turn On

A garbage disposal that refuses to start could have a tripped reset button, a faulty wall switch, compromised internal wiring, or a burned-out motor. Without trained inspection, homeowners might miss underlying electrical hazards.

Slow Drainage

If water accumulates in the sink before draining, the disposal or the adjacent P-trap may be partially blocked. Cooking grease flushed down drains can solidify in cooler pipes, combining with food particles to form stubborn clogs.

The Step-By-Step HEP Garbage Disposal Repair Process

Initial Assessment and Safety Check

  1. Shut off power at the circuit breaker
  2. Confirm voltage absence at the unit’s wiring box
  3. Inspect under-sink plumbing for leaks or corrosion
  4. Evaluate splash guard condition and drainpipe alignment

Unit Disassembly and Cleaning

After ensuring safety, HEP technicians detach the disposal from the mounting assembly, remove trapped debris, and clean mineral deposits with a hydrochloric-acid-free solution. Components are soaked, scrubbed, and rinsed to reveal hidden cracks or warping.

Component Replacement or Repair

Broken flyweights, damaged shredder rings, or burnt armatures are replaced with manufacturer-approved parts. When wear is minimal, technicians realign and lubricate bearings, tightening fasteners to factory specifications.

System Testing and Calibration

With the unit reassembled, plumbers restore power, run cold water, and feed ice cubes or citrus peels to confirm smooth operation. Vibration levels, noise output, and amperage draw are recorded, ensuring the motor operates within safe limits.

Preventive Maintenance Tips From HEP Plumbers

  • Run cold water before, during, and after disposal use to solidify oils and flush particles.
  • Feed small food quantities gradually instead of dumping large loads at once.
  • Grind citrus rinds weekly to reduce odors naturally.
  • Avoid fibrous materials such as corn husks, celery stalks, and onion skins.
  • Never pour fats, oils, or grease into the disposal; collect and discard them separately.
  • Press the reset button only after confirming obstructions are cleared to prevent repeated overload triggers.
  • Schedule an annual inspection to detect early signs of wear.

The Role of Huntsville’s Water Quality in Garbage Disposal Performance

Huntsville draws water from both surface and groundwater sources, resulting in moderate hardness that leaves calcium and magnesium deposits on metal surfaces. Inside a garbage disposal, these minerals accumulate on impellers and shredder rings, gradually dulling the cutting edges. Dull blades force the motor to work harder, increasing the risk of overheating. HEP addresses water-quality challenges by recommending periodic descaling treatments tailored to the region’s hardness levels. Incorporating a water softener further extends disposal life by reducing mineral contact, lessening noise, and improving grind efficiency.

Foods That Commonly Cause Blockages

  • Potato peels and rice, which swell when combined with water
  • Coffee grounds that clump together and resist breakdown
  • Artichoke leaves and asparagus ends with dense, fibrous strands
  • Eggshell membranes that wrap around impellers
  • Pasta, especially large amounts, that congeal in drainpipes
  • Fruit pits or bones that damage grinding components
  • Grease-coated foods that cool and solidify downstream

Signs It’s Time to Call HEP’s Garbage Disposal Pros

  • Frequent resets or tripped breakers after short usage periods
  • Water seeping from the bottom housing—indicative of seal failure
  • A lingering burnt smell, suggesting motor winding damage
  • Constant humming without grinding action even after manual jam clearing
  • Backed-up sinks despite drain chemical treatments
  • Visible rust flakes or cracks on the outer casing

Misconceptions About Garbage Disposals Debunked by HEP Technicians

  • Myth: Ice cubes sharpen blades.
    Reality: Ice cleans the grinding chamber but does not sharpen stainless-steel parts.

  • Myth: Lemon juice ruins disposals.
    Reality: Citrus acid is mild and, when used sparingly, helps sanitize and deodorize without corroding components.

  • Myth: Hot water is best during grinding.
    Reality: Hot water melts fats, which later solidify in pipes. Cold water keeps greases solid for easier grinding and flushing.

  • Myth: Any food waste is acceptable.
    Reality: Stringy vegetables, bones, and expandable starches should stay out of the disposal to protect internal mechanisms and drains.

The Connection Between Garbage Disposal and Overall Plumbing Health

A garbage disposal is the first line of defense against large food particles entering a home’s wastewater system. When it operates efficiently, downstream pipes experience reduced buildup, sewer lines remain clear, and septic systems remain balanced. Conversely, malfunctioning disposals allow larger debris to enter drains, accelerating pipe corrosion, fostering bacterial colonies, and increasing hydrostatic pressure. HEP evaluates the entire under-sink ecosystem—P-traps, venting, air gaps, and dishwasher discharge lines—to confirm that each component supports optimal flow, thereby preserving the integrity of the household’s complete plumbing infrastructure.

Indicators of Imminent Motor Failure

A healthy garbage disposal motor hums at a consistent pitch and achieves full speed within seconds. Symptoms of imminent failure include:

  • Delayed startup accompanied by low-frequency rumbling
  • Intermittent power loss even when no blockage exists
  • Excess heat radiating from the housing after brief operation
  • Darkened, brittle insulation on exposed wiring
  • Visible sparking or arcing when the unit cycles off

HEP identifies these red flags early, replacing motors before catastrophic burnout scorches internal circuitry or damages surrounding cabinetry.

Integrating Dishwashers and Garbage Disposals

Many Huntsville kitchens channel dishwasher discharge through the disposal’s upper inlet. A dysfunctional disposal can backflow food particles into the dishwasher, so HEP evaluates check valves and inlet tees during each repair. Ensuring proper siphon breaks, venting, and waste line alignment prevents cross-contamination and keeps both appliances functioning efficiently.
